Detailed analysis of the Mitsubishi Montero 3p 3.2 DI-D GLS Aut. · 160 CV (2003-2004)

General description

The 2003 Mitsubishi Montero 3p 3.2 DI-D GLS Aut. is a robust and reliable SUV, designed for those seeking adventure without sacrificing comfort. With its 160 HP diesel engine and all-wheel drive, this vehicle presents itself as an ideal companion for both the city and the most demanding terrains.

Driving experience

Behind the wheel of the Montero, the feeling of control and safety is palpable. Its 3.2-liter diesel engine delivers a powerful 160 HP, which is especially felt in the mid-range of revolutions, offering an energetic response. The 5-speed automatic transmission, although not the fastest, performs its function smoothly, making long journeys more pleasant. On the road, its suspension absorbs irregularities well, providing a comfortable ride, while off-road, its off-road capability shines brightly, overcoming obstacles with surprising ease. The steering, although not the most direct, offers the necessary assistance to maneuver this imposing vehicle.

Technology and features

In 2003, the Mitsubishi Montero incorporated solid and proven technology. Its direct injection diesel engine, turbo and intercooler, was a benchmark in efficiency and performance for its time. The permanent all-wheel drive, along with the 5-speed automatic gearbox, guaranteed excellent performance on any surface. In terms of safety, it had ventilated disc brakes on both axles, providing effective braking. Although it did not have the latest driving aids of today, its technological equipment was focused on durability and off-road capability, key elements for its segment.

Competition

In its time, the Mitsubishi Montero competed with SUVs such as the Toyota Land Cruiser, the Nissan Patrol, and the Land Rover Discovery. Compared to them, the Montero stood out for its balance between off-road capability and on-road comfort, offering a very competitive alternative in the segment of robust and reliable 4x4s. Its diesel engine and automatic transmission were strong points that positioned it favorably against its rivals.
